摘要:

目的 调查老年单侧全髋关节置换患者术后康复期参与生产性活动现状并分析其影响因素,旨在为临床护理实践提供借鉴。 方法 采用便利抽样方法,选取2024年5—11月连云港市某三级甲等医院关节外科收治的242例老年单侧全髋关节置换患者作为调查对象,于其术后首次下床接受康复训练1周后采用一般资料调查问卷、生产性参与量表、改良Barthel指数评定量表、焦虑自评量表、抑郁自评量表、社区老年人跌倒风险感知量表、恐动症Tampa评分量表17条目版、领悟社会支持量表、老年人社会隔离量表进行调查。 结果 回收有效问卷230份,老年单侧全髋关节置换患者术后康复期生产性参与量表得分为(31.13±3.69)分,多元线性回归分析显示,年龄、文化程度、居住地、BMI是否正常、合并慢性疾病数量、距离手术时间、生活是否能自理、跌倒风险感知、有无恐动症、领悟社会支持和社会隔离是老年单侧全髋关节置换患者术后康复期参与生产性活动的影响因素(P<0.05)。 结论 老年单侧全髋关节置换患者术后康复期参与生产性活动水平较低,并受到多种因素影响,医护人员应根据以上影响因素制订针对性的干预方案,提升其参与生产性活动水平。

Abstract:

Objective To investigate the current status of productive engagement of elderly patients undergoing unilateral total hip arthroplasty in postoperative rehabilitation period. Methods From May to Novermber 2024,242 elderly patients undergoing the first total hip arthroplasty from the joint surgery department of Nanjing Medical University Kangda College First Affiliated Hospital were selected as investigation subjects. They were investigated in postoperative rehabilitation period after receiving rehabilitation training for a week at getting out of bed for the first time after surgery by the Basic Information Questionnaire,Productive Engagement Scale,Improved Barthel Index Rating Scale,Self-Rating Anxiety Scale,Self-Rating Depression Scale,Fall Risk Perception Scale for Community-dwelling Older Adults,Tampa Rating Scale(17 Item Version),Perceived Social Support Scale and Social Isolation Scale for the Elderly. Results In the 230 valid questionnaires,the score of productive engagement of elderly patients undergoing unilateral total hip arthroplasty was(31.13±3.69) points in postoperative rehabilitation period. The Linear regression analysis showed that age,education level,place of residence,normal BMI,number of coexisting chronic diseases,time after surgery,ability of self-care,fall risk perception,Tampa,perceived social support and social isolation were all significant influencing factors for productive engagement of elderly patients undergoing unilateral total hip arthroplasty in postoperative rehabilitation period(P<0.05). Conclusion The level of productive engagement of elderly patients undergoing unilateral total hip arthroplasty in postoperative rehabilitation period is relatively low. Their productive engagement were influenced by many factors. Clinical medical staff should develop intervention plans based on such influence factors to improve their level of productive participation.
